Set gaps when the x axis is NULL
Gaps are requested to QCustomPlot when one of the coordinates of a point is NaN. We were using that feature for the y axis, but not for the x axis where null values where being converted to 0, which makes less sense than making a gap, at least for consistency. See issue #1977
